Overview of OpenAI’s ChatGPT & Google Gemini

OpenAI’s ChatGPT

ChatGPT was developed by OpenAI in November 2022. Its verbal skills help its users to have human-like interaction with technology. It helps in solving user queries in any domain via natural language processing. As of now, we all are well versed with the term ‘ChatGPT’ which has become popular for its tailored results. GPT-4 Turbo is the latest AI model that aims mainly at customization.

Google Gemini

Google’s support for technically skilled LLMs brings ‘Gemini’ into the limelight. It was launched by Sundar Pichai in December 2023. A successful merger of Google Brain and DeepMind extends support to the Gemini model. 3. Can ChatGPT respond to an image?

As per the latest growths, ChatGPT can see an image and process it to reply to a query. Users can add images to their prompts with descriptions and ask their queries. ChatGPT can decode the patterns and give related answers.
